Classic versus Techy Toys: Safety Still Comes First
Newer toys are more sophisticated compared to previous models, and some toys have chips and electronic devices embedded in them to maximize the experience. The classics never lose their charm, though, and most are usually rebranded with new cartoon characters or designs to tickle the fancy with whats currently popular. The rules of choosing toddler toys still apply, though. Safety is your first priority, and you have to weed out toys with safety or choking hazards. Note that even varieties considered as age-appropriate may contain small or loose parts, either as factory defects or as part of the specifications; fidget with each piece thoroughly before you consider purchasing the package.
Keep Your Childs Toy Box Assortments Diverse
Some toys are mere distractions, while others have educational value. Your childs toy box should contain enough of both varieties. Stuffed toys and dolls come in handy when you want to appease boredom, while educational toys like puzzles encourage your child to work on developing skills during activity hours. Use the age-appropriate labels as your guide when choosing assortments. These are usually standardized so youre childs age and maturity is covered for, but its up to you to determine if the toy is too simple or difficult to play with. Puzzle toys, for example, vary in number and complexity of pieces, and a 15-piece puzzle of complicated shapes may not match your toddlers capabilities. Consider your childs current assortment of toys, and choose varieties more complicated than the ones completed with ease and familiarity.
Puzzle Toys should be Doable and Durable
Toddler puzzles should be chunky and colorful, in designs which easily snap into place with enough effort. Wooden puzzles are ideal because these are more durable; toddlers have a knack for chewing on everything they can get their hands onto. Youll have to guide your child along if the puzzle becomes too frustrating, or you can bring out a simpler toy and motivate him with a quick accomplishment.
